Originally Posted by SmokeySS
I put Lexol on my dash and that gave off a really bad glare, enough to definately be dangerous.
Did you put Lexol on the whole dash, including the horizontal panel that has the defrost vent that fits between the windshield and the A-pillars? I'm thinking that if one were to smooth JUST the front of the dash, but leave the defrost vent panel with a grain finish along with maybe adding a tint band across the top of the windshield, it would help out with glare alot. Seems like with things set up that way, sunlight would have to be coming in from a pretty steep angle to cast glare so it would probably only be bad during certain hours of the day.
